Algebra is the branch of mathematics that uses symbols to solve equations and describe relationships between variables. It has practical applications in fields like engineering, physics, and finance. Algebraic thinking involves breaking down complex problems into simpler parts using symbolic notation.
Fractions are a way of representing parts of a whole, where the whole is divided into equal parts. They are an essential part of mathematics, used in a variety of applications, from cooking and baking to finance and engineering. Understanding fractions is crucial for problem-solving and mathematical literacy, and it is an important foundation for more advanced mathematical concepts.
Integers are the set of whole numbers and their negatives, including zero. They are an essential part of mathematics, used in a wide range of applications from counting and measuring to algebra and calculus. Understanding integers is crucial for mathematical literacy, problem-solving, and critical thinking, and it provides a foundation for more advanced mathematical concepts.
Music is an art form that uses sound as its medium of expression. It can evoke emotions, tell stories, and connect people across cultures and generations. Music is created through a variety of techniques, including melody, harmony, rhythm, and timbre, and it has a long history of cultural and social significance. Whether as a listener, performer, or composer, music can enrich our lives and provide a means of personal expression and creativity.
Anatomy is the branch of biology that deals with the study of the structure and organization of living organisms. It is a fundamental part of medicine and other health sciences, providing a detailed understanding of the human body's internal and external structures. Anatomy covers a broad range of topics, from the microscopic structures of cells and tissues to the macroscopic structures of organs and organ systems. Understanding anatomy is crucial for medical professionals and researchers, as well as for individuals seeking to maintain their health and well-being.
Physiology is the branch of biology that deals with the study of the functions and processes of living organisms. It encompasses a wide range of topics, from the functions of cells and tissues to the workings of organ systems and the regulation of bodily functions. Physiologists study how organisms work and adapt to changes in their environment, including the regulation of body temperature, the digestion of food, the movement of muscles, and the processing of sensory information. Understanding physiology is essential for health professionals, athletes, and individuals seeking to maintain optimal health and well-being.
Pharmacology is the branch of medicine that deals with the study of drugs and their effects on living organisms. It involves the study of how drugs interact with biological systems, and how they are absorbed, distributed, metabolized, and excreted by the body. Pharmacologists work to develop and test new drugs, as well as to improve the safety and efficacy of existing medications. They collaborate with other medical professionals to determine the best treatment options for patients, based on their unique medical histories and conditions. Understanding pharmacology is crucial for medical professionals, researchers, and individuals seeking to make informed decisions about their own health and well-being.
Genetics is the branch of biology that deals with the study of heredity and variation in living organisms. It encompasses a wide range of topics, from the structure and function of DNA to the study of how traits are passed down from one generation to the next. Geneticists study the underlying mechanisms of inheritance, including genetic mutations, gene expression, and the interactions between genes and the environment. They use this knowledge to develop new treatments and therapies for genetic disorders, and to better understand the genetic factors that contribute to complex diseases like cancer and diabetes. Understanding genetics is essential for medical professionals, researchers, and individuals seeking to make informed decisions about their health and well-being.
